Transaction 758f7aeb654e974a2f39d89aba8c7d65b8f59aa20dbd6cb3320d3f587d25e646
3 Input
2 Outputs
- 758f7aeb654e974a2f39d89aba8c7d65b8f59aa20dbd6cb3320d3f587d25e646:0
- 758f7aeb654e974a2f39d89aba8c7d65b8f59aa20dbd6cb3320d3f587d25e646:1
value 1044177
address 1AgXEhwyHSFbBw2NkvdnTrWvCvcTLvbFvv
value 25074439
address 1MEPWNmrSC1LwPY3ZEHu29Uitxgi86mSRc